Fanduel Sports Network's John Sadak and Jeff Brantley marveled at Cincinnati Reds shortstop Elly De La Cruz's leaping catch to end the fourth inning during Wednesday's series finale against the Giants in San Francisco.

"Did you see that?" Brantley said during the broadcast. "Oh my goodness, that guy is unbelievable."

After the commercial break, Brantley continued to praise De La Cruz's effort on the play.

"I'm still trying to catch my breath over this. That ball was hit like a rocket. I don't know that any other shortstop can make that play. Number one, they can't jump that high. And number two, they can't reach that far. That's like stupid good."

"He's one of the few men in the game to have the Nike Jumpman line," Sadak added. "He's his own logo. It's just hard to decide what pose you want it to be. … There are few in this game as capable of the incredible."

"I think you're right on with that," Brantley added.
